In regards to the Guide

Can everybody’s favorite insurance coverage mathematician, Henri, mix the more and more harmful world of journey parks with the unpredictability of blended-family life? He’s about to search out out within the remaining instalment of the hilarious, nail-biting Rabbit Issue Trilogy.

Henri Koskinen, intrepid insurance coverage mathematician and adventure-park entrepreneur, firmly believes within the energy of widespread sense and order. That’s till he strikes in with painter Laura Helanto and her daughter…

As Henri realises he has inadvertently grow to be a part of a gaggle of native dads, a competing journey park is in search of to increase their operations, not all the time sticking to the regulation within the course of…

Is it attainable to mix the more and more harmful world of the adventure-park enterprise with the unpredictability of life in a blended household? At first look, the 2 seem to have just one factor in widespread: neither offers notably properly with a mounting physique rely.

As a way to clear up this seemingly unimaginable conundrum, Henri is compelled to step far past the mathematical precision of his consolation zone … and the stakes have by no means been increased…

Warmly humorous, quirky, touching, and a nail-biting triumph of a thriller, The Beaver Principle is the ultimate instalment within the award-winning Rabbit Issue Trilogy, as Henri encounters the largest problem of his profession, with hair-raising outcomes…

My Ideas

Oh, Henri. How I’ll miss him. However there could possibly be no higher ship off than this, a e book which mixes all of the fantastic golden humour that we have now come to count on from Antti Tuomainen and this collection, combining it with a contact of thrill and a complete host of optimistic feelings. The Beaver Principle finds Henri on the cusp of a(nother) main change in his life, and but it’s removed from being the top of his journey of discovery. He has come a great distance from the tight, logic pushed recovering insurance coverage actuary we met in The Rabbit Issue, to being a good logic pushed, energetic journey park proprietor with parental duties, and never only for Laura Helanto’s daughter, Tuuli, both.

Now this collection has grow to be synonymous with the slapstick type, excessive jeopardy opening, one wherein at the least one individual falls foul of an uncommon destiny, and The Beaver Principle isn’t any exception. There will likely be little doubt as to the that means behind the title after the opening chapter, however regardless of that small thriller being solved comparatively rapidly, the why’s and wherefores of the story, and the way Henri, as soon as once more, finally ends up underneath suspicion of a deed most dangerous, will take somewhat longer to elucidate. Drawing readers again by way of the seven days main as much as that fateful and chucklesome prologue, the Antti Tuomainen regularly reveals the twisted happenings that appear to be resulting in a extreme decline in fortune for Henri’s YouMeFun Journey Park. For sure there are some lower than virtuous antagonists in play, and this time they’ve some surprising again up.

As a lot because the thriller that surrounds the prologue performs a key half within the story, and we do, in spite of everything, need to know precisely what occurred and why, for me it’s the characters that make this collection actually particular. From the unhealthy guys, as comedic and Fargo-esque as their endeavours could also be, to the opposite Faculty Dads in Henri’s new ‘friendship group’, every provides color and vibrancy to the story. Henri’s relationship with Laura Helanto is good and seeing how he has modified a lot by being in her life, actually does make me smile when they’re in scene’s collectively. And watching him navigate life as a brand new Dad can be enjoyable – not one thing that may simply be managed by way of a collection of mathematical calculations – though his capabilities on this space do earn him some kudos amongst the opposite dads.

However above all else I like Henri and his YouMeFun household, as a result of that’s what they are surely. Every of them, Esa, Kristian, Johanna, Sampaa and Minttu Ok, are so distinctive and but brilliantly imagined that they create such a optimistic and heat feeling while you examine them, even in probably the most dire of circumstances that they face on this remaining episode of the collection. By means of them, their willpower and dedication, Henri learns a priceless life lesson, one which spurs him on to extra decided motion. Henri, being Henri, it doesn’t all the time finish in one of the best ways, and there are many scenes wherein his actions see issues get utterly out of hand, the story all the higher for it. His private progress all through the collection although has been a pleasure to learn, and his typically too critical, matter of truth observations contradict the comedic tone of the motion so brilliantly that I all the time discover myself with an enormous smile on my face when I’m studying.

As soon as once more the pacing is excellent, the story madcap however compelling, with the writer’s trademark humour en-pointe, ensuing within the supply of a pitch good finale. An enormous shout out to David Hackston, whose persistently skilful translation of the writer’s work has introduced Henri and his mates to life on the web page, permitting us all to indulge of their hilarious antics for one remaining time. Unusually, the unhappiness I felt when enthusiastic about this being the final e book typically felt as if it was mirrored within the extra melancholic and reflective moments of the e book, however they’re fleeting and few, and it isn’t lengthy earlier than the positivity and good humour shine by way of.

So while I’ll miss Henri and the gang, with a particular adios reserved for expensive Schopenhauer, I depart them with a smile on my face and the information that the top to Henri’s story is a becoming one. Most undoubtedly beneficial. And for the e book, and the collection, a remaining one in every of these.

In regards to the Creator

Finnish Antti Tuomainen was an award-winning copywriter when he made his literary debut in 2007 as a suspense writer in 2013, the Finnish press topped Tuomainen the ‘King of Helsinki Noir’ when Darkish as My Coronary heart was revealed. With a piercing and evocative type, Tuomainen was one of many first to problem the Scandinavian crime style formulation, and his poignant, darkish and hilarious The Man Who Died grew to become a world bestseller, shortlisting for the Petrona and Final Snort Awards. Palm Seaside Finland was an immense success, with Marcel Berlins (The Occasions) calling Tuomainen ‘the funniest author in Europe’. Little Siberia (2020), was shortlisted for the CWA Worldwide Dagger, the Amazon Publishing/Capital Crime Awards and the CrimeFest Final Snort Award, and gained the Petrona Award for Greatest Scandinavian Crime Novel of the Yr. The Rabbit Issue (2021), the primary e book in Antti’s first ever collection,is in manufacturing by Amazon Studios with Steve Carell starring.The Moose Paradox, e book two within the collection is out in 2022.

In regards to the Translator

David Hackston is a British Translator of Finnish and Swedish literature and drama. Notable publications embody The Dedalus Guide of Finnish Fantasy, Maria Peura’s coming-of-age novel On the Fringe of Gentle, Johanna Sinisalo’s eco-thriller Birdbrain, two crime novels by Matti Joensuu and Kati Hiekkapelto’s Anna Fekete collection (which at the moment contains The HummingbirdThe Defenceless and The Exiled, all revealed by Orenda Books). He additionally interprets Antti Tuomainen’s tales. In 2007 he was awarded the Finnish State Prize for Translation. David can be knowledgeable countertenor and a founding member of the English Vocal Consort of Helsinki.
